Any stock LC you snag these days needs recapped, maybe even the power supply too. I recapped one LC PS recently and it wasn't that bad actually.

 
Don't forget the Apple IIe cards have a few caps as well, as do the 12" LC toppers. (Most video problems in those are caused by the caps, not the flyback or anything else).
